Abstract :
This paper describes the theoretical analysis regarding the resonance frequency and electrical equivalent circuit constants characteristics vs. plate surface roughnesses for the AT-cut resonators which are adsorbing and without adsorbing for relative humidity. A new electric equivalent circuit theory was proposed, and the experimental proof was conducted by means of both the impedance analyzer and network analyzer measuring systems. Our theory was agreed with experimental results. This paper describes the experimental results on the plate roughness effect of relative humidity on the AT-cut quartz humidity sensors. This research was conducted to investigate principally the mechanism with respect to the resonance frequency changes influenced by relative humidity change etc. (including the impedance changes and equivalent circuit constant fluctuations) for the above humidity sensors.
